How Much Is 1863 Deep River National Bank of Deep River Connecticut $1 Worth? 1863 $2 Bill Value ...All 1928E $2 red seals are from the DA block, meaning that non-star serial numbers start with D and end with A. Somewhere around 6.5 million 1928E two dollar red seal bills were printed. The message from the White House on immigration is becoming clear: Donald Trump won’t sign any immigra...A heavily circulated 1928C two dollar bill can be bought at will for about $5. A nicer looking, but still circulated 1928C two shouldn’t cost more than $20. A choice uncirculated note typically retails for around $75. There is one slight variation to the 1928C $2 red seal that can be very valuable. That variety is the 1928C $2 mule.

The 1928 $2 Legal Tender notes were printed in eight different series, 1928 to 1928G, and encompassed five different blocks, A-A to E-A, plus Stars. This series offered several tough and rare varieties to collect. Some of these varieties include notes without backplate serial numbers engraved, Mules with macro backplates, a tough regular Non ...
